Possible Causes of Refrigerator Leak Damage
Refrigerator leaks are a common household problem that can cause significant water damage if not addressed promptly. The most frequent cause is a worn or damaged door gasket. When the seal around the refrigerator door fails, warm air enters, leading to excess condensation and potential leaks. Over time, this moisture can seep into surrounding floors and cabinets, resulting in costly repairs and mold growth if left untreated.
Another common cause is a clogged or frozen defrost drain. When the drain becomes blocked, excess water from defrost cycles can pool and leak out onto the floor. Additionally, issues with the water supply line—such as cracks, loose fittings, or a burst hose—can cause water to escape unexpectedly. These leaks often go unnoticed until they cause visible water damage or mold development, making early detection and professional restoration crucial.

What are the signs of a leaking refrigerator?
Look for pooling water around your refrigerator, increased humidity, or visible water stains on floors and walls. Unusual noises or ice buildup can also indicate leaks. If you notice any of these signs, contact our experts for an inspection.

Can you prevent future refrigerator leaks?
Regular maintenance, such as inspecting door seals, defrost drains, and water lines, can prevent leaks. We also offer tips and guidance to help you keep your refrigerator functioning properly and avoid costly repairs down the line.
